package org.encog.platformspecific.j2se.data;
import java.sql.Connection;
import org.encog.ml.data.basic.BasicMLDataSet;
import org.encog.ml.data.buffer.MemoryDataLoader;
import org.encog.ml.data.buffer.codec.DataSetCODEC;
import org.encog.ml.data.buffer.codec.SQLCODEC;
/**
* A dataset based on a SQL query. This is not a memory based dataset, so it can
* handle very large datasets without a memory issue. This class makes use of
* JDBC to query the database.
*
* If you are running into "out of memory" issues with this class try setting a
* lower "fetch size". This can be done with:
*
* SQLCODEC.FETCH_SIZE = 1000;
*
*/
public class SQLNeuralDataSet extends BasicMLDataSet {
/**
*
*/
private static final long serialVersionUID = 1L;
/**
* Create a SQLNeuralDataSet based on the specified connection. This
* connection WILL NOT be closed when the close method is called.
*
* @param theConnection
* The connection to use.
* @param theSQL
* The SQL command to execute.
* @param theInputSize
* The size of the input data.
* @param theIdealSize
* The size of the ideal data.
*/
public SQLNeuralDataSet(
final Connection theConnection, final String theSQL,
final int theInputSize, final int theIdealSize) {
DataSetCODEC codec = new SQLCODEC(theConnection, theSQL, theInputSize,
theIdealSize);
MemoryDataLoader load = new MemoryDataLoader(codec);
load.setResult(this);
load.external2Memory();
}
/**
* Construct a SQL dataset. A connection will be opened, this connection
* will be closed when the close method is called.
*
* @param sql
* The SQL command to execute.
* @param inputSize
* The size of the input data.
* @param idealSize
* The size of the ideal data.
* @param driver
* The driver to use.
* @param url
* The database connection URL.
* @param uid
* The database user id.
* @param pwd
* The database password.
*/
public SQLNeuralDataSet(final String sql, final int inputSize,
final int idealSize, final String driver, final String url,
final String uid, final String pwd) {
DataSetCODEC codec = new SQLCODEC(sql, inputSize, idealSize, driver,
url, uid, pwd);
MemoryDataLoader load = new MemoryDataLoader(codec);
load.setResult(this);
load.external2Memory();
}
}
